Improving the trasient response of a turbocharged diesel engine by using electrical assisting systems
It is a well-known fact that turbocharged diesel engine suffer from inadequate response to sudden load increases, which is a consequence of the nature of the energy exchange between the engine and the turbocharger. The dynamic response of turbocharged diesel engine could be improved by the use of electrical assisting systems, either by direct energy supply with an integrated starter-generator mounted on the engine flywheel or indirect energy supply with an electricaly assisted turbocharger. A previously verified zero-dimensional model computer simulation method was used for the analysis of both concepts of electrical assistance. The reliability of presented data is additionaly ensured by the experimentaly determined characteristics of the electric motors used as input parameters for the simulation. The paper offers an analysis of the interaction between the turbocharged diesel engine and the electrical assisting systems as well as the requirements for electric motors that are suitable for the improvement of an engine's dynamic response in a vehicle. The presented results of vehicle dynamics indicate the features and differences of both concepts of electrical assistance.
